DIY Beauty Masks

This cold weather has not been kind on my skin. I've been hunting for the perfect moisturizing facial mask for Winter weather. I have found many DIY masks, but the only problem is they involve too many ingredients for my liking (I have the same issue with cooking/baking - If I have to google image what ingredients I'm buying, no way jose am I making that).  I have found a few that include TWO ingredients only, and you're pretty likely to have these stocked in your fridge... SCORE! 


Avocado and Yogurt
1 ripe avocado
4 tablespoons of plain yogurt
Blend in food processor and leave on for 10-15 min


Banana and Lemon
1 ripe banana
1/2 teaspoon of lemon
(optional- you can add oatmeal or agave)
Blend together until smooth. Apply and leave on for 15-20 min


 Honey and Milk
2 tablespoons of honey
2 teaspoons of milk
Mixture will be sticky. Apply and leave on for 10-15 min



Honey and Egg 
2 tablespoons of honey
1 egg yolk
Blend together thoroughly. Apply and leave on for 10-15 min
